    The Customization Edge

    One of the most compelling reasons Linux is favored among professionals is its open-source nature. This characteristic not only makes Linux the best Linux for web development but also allows for extensive customization tailored to specific project needs—a dream for any developer.

    Flexibility in Software Choices: The ability to choose from a vast array of software packages means developers can build a completely customized development environment that fits their unique workflow.Community Driven Enhancements: With the power of a global community of developers, Linux continually evolves with contributions that enhance functionality and user experience.Customization at the Kernel Level: Developers aren’t limited to surface-level adjustments; they can tweak Linux at the kernel level to optimize performance for their specific projects.Variety of Distributions: Linux offers various distributions, each tailored for different types of users and usage scenarios, from desktops to servers, enhancing its versatility as a development platform.Access to Cutting-Edge Tools: Linux users often receive access to the latest software tools before those on other platforms, providing an edge in utilizing new technologies and methodologies.

    Expanding Creative Horizons

    Utilizing Linux art programs opens up new possibilities for creative expression. These programs range from vector graphics tools like Inkscape to powerful image editors such as GIMP, offering capabilities that rival and sometimes surpass their commercial counterparts.

    Stability and Performance: Linux’s Hallmarks

    Linux’s architecture contributes significantly to its reputation for stability and high performance. Websites and applications hosted on Linux are known for exceptional uptime, making Linux the best Linux OS for developers who prioritize reliability and speed in their projects.

    Security: A Top Priority

    Security is paramount in web development, and Linux excels in this area. Its robust built-in security features and proactive community support ensure that security patches and updates are timely, minimizing vulnerabilities. This focus on security is why many consider Linux the best OS for software development, where security can make or break the success of a project.
